Output eba1a23f5586c767078204d42f124279f1d0fb08d415536b181ccefc4b206c75:0

value
586901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26effec83331ce7ea684cb1a63863c08de66fb8d OP_EQUAL
address
35Eu6zfhq1NcEKZXP6putBsSxHe1VLweMD
transaction
eba1a23f5586c767078204d42f124279f1d0fb08d415536b181ccefc4b206c75
spent
true